The Rise of AI in Podcasting
Podcasting has seen explosive growth over the past decade. Once a niche medium, it has now become a mainstream channel for storytelling, news, education, and entertainment. According to a 2023 report by Edison Research, over 57% of Americans have listened to a podcast, with 78% aware of them. This rapid growth has been driven by the accessibility of podcast creation and consumption, but also by technological advancements, particularly in AI.
AI's integration into podcasting is not entirely new. Tools have been used for transcription, audio editing, and even content recommendation. However, Spotify's latest features mark a significant leap forward by leveraging AI for content generation and user interaction.

Spotify's AI-Powered Q&A Feature
At the heart of Spotify's new offerings is its AI-powered Q&A feature. This tool allows listeners to interact with podcasts in a way that's never been possible before. Imagine listening to a podcast and being able to ask questions like, “What was the main point of that last segment?” or “Can you summarize the guest's views on climate change?” Spotify's AI can process these queries and provide immediate, concise answers.
How It Works
Spotify's Q&A feature is powered by advanced natural language processing (NLP) algorithms. These algorithms analyze the podcast's audio content, transcribe it, and then use machine learning models to understand and respond to user queries.
The AI learns from a vast dataset of podcast transcripts and user interactions, continuously improving its response accuracy. This ensures that over time, the tool becomes better at understanding context and delivering relevant answers.

Briefing Generation: Personalized Podcasting
Another groundbreaking feature Spotify has introduced is AI-powered briefing generation. This tool enables users to create custom podcasts tailored to their interests and schedules. Whether it's a daily news digest or a weekly summary of industry trends, Spotify's AI can generate content that suits individual needs.
Creating Custom Briefs
Users can prompt the AI with specific requests like “Summarize today's tech news” or “Give me a five-minute briefing on the latest in renewable energy.” The AI then compiles the necessary information from a variety of sources, creating a coherent and engaging podcast episode.

Challenges and Solutions
Implementing AI in podcasting is not without its challenges. Here are some common pitfalls and potential solutions:
Challenges
- Data Privacy: With AI processing user queries and generating content, concerns about data privacy and security are paramount.
- Accuracy: Ensuring the AI accurately transcribes and understands podcast content can be difficult, especially with diverse accents and speech patterns.
- Bias: AI models are only as good as the data they're trained on, which can introduce bias into the generated content.
Solutions
- Robust Privacy Policies: Spotify must implement and communicate strong privacy policies to assure users that their data is safe and only used for enhancing their experience.
- Continuous Training: Regularly updating AI models with diverse datasets can improve transcription accuracy and reduce bias.
- Transparency: Providing users with insight into how AI models make decisions can build trust and encourage more engagement.
